SQL SERVER项目案例(sql代码)


在SQL Server数据库管理系统中,项目案例通常涉及到一系列的实际应用场景,涵盖了数据存储、查询优化、事务处理、安全性控制、备份恢复等多个方面。以下是一些可能在"SQL SERVER项目案例"中涉及的重要知识点: 1. **数据建模与设计**:这是任何数据库项目的基础,包括关系模型设计、ER图绘制,以及表的创建,如主键、外键、索引的设定,以确保数据的一致性和完整性。 2. **T-SQL编程**:SQL Server主要通过T-SQL(Transact-SQL)进行数据操作,包括插入、更新、删除数据,以及复杂的查询语句编写,如JOIN、子查询、聚合函数等。 3. **存储过程与触发器**:存储过程是预编译的SQL语句集合,可以提高性能,常用于业务逻辑处理。触发器则在特定的数据操作(如INSERT、UPDATE、DELETE)前后自动执行,用于实现数据的自动维护。 4. **视图与索引**:视图是虚拟表,用于简化复杂查询,提供安全访问。索引则是加速查询的关键,包括聚集索引和非聚集索引,合理设计能极大提升查询效率。 5. **性能优化**:涉及查询优化器的选择、索引的使用、查询语句的优化(如避免全表扫描、减少笛卡尔积),以及性能监控工具的使用,如SQL Server Profiler。 6. **数据库安全**:包括用户权限管理、角色定义、登录账户设置,以及审计策略的实施,确保数据的安全访问。 7. **备份与恢复**:SQL Server提供了多种备份类型,如完整备份、差异备份、日志备份,以及相应的恢复模式,以应对数据丢失或系统故障。 8. **复制技术**:用于数据的分布和同步,包括事务复制、合并复制和快照复制,适用于分布式系统或需要实时数据同步的场景。 9. **高可用性与灾难恢复**:例如,SQL Server的镜像、 AlwaysOn 可用性组等技术,可以提供高可用性,防止单点故障。 10. **大数据与云服务**:SQL Server与Azure云服务集成,支持大数据解决方案,如Azure SQL Database和Azure Data Lake。 以上知识点只是“SQL SERVER项目案例”中可能涉及的一部分,具体案例可能涵盖更深入的实战技巧和最佳实践。在实际操作中,根据项目需求,还需要灵活应用并不断学习新的特性和技术。
































- 1


- 粉丝: 3
我的内容管理 展开
我的资源 快来上传第一个资源
我的收益
登录查看自己的收益我的积分 登录查看自己的积分
我的C币 登录后查看C币余额
我的收藏
我的下载
下载帮助


最新资源
- 中学迁建项目300米田径场工程施工招标文件.doc
- -GB5004-015《混凝土结构工程施工质量验收规范》新规范解读.pptx
- 质量、安全、环境体系内审员讲义ppt.ppt
- 2011年住宅楼施工总承包招标书.doc
- 基于DeepSeek的LLMs:训练框架、推理优化和自适应技术揭秘
- 浦北龙门风电场一期100MW工程220kV升压站土建工程技术文件.doc
- 员工月度总结书.doc
- 电杆上路灯安装质量管理.doc
- 预制钢筋混凝土框架结构构件安装工艺.doc
- 抽样结果记录.docx
- 固定资产报废申请表.doc
- 语文试卷答题纸.doc
- 南京中海地产项目部管理制度.doc
- 绪论-档案学基础.ppt
- 工程危险因素识别评价表(民用建筑部分).doc
- 工程部工作流程图及管理制度.doc


